Vectorious conducted a study which comes to assess the safety, the usability and the feasibility of the V-LAPTM, its novel wireless left atrial pressure sensor, to accurately measure left atrial pressure.

The Vectorious Medical Technologies V-LAPTM is a novel intracardiac HF monitoring system, based on a micro-computer sensory implant. It is the first fully digital, wireless left atrial pressure (LAP) sensor, which enables bi-directional communication with an external unit, as well as compensation for drift in pressure. The objective of this study was to assess the safety, the usability and the feasibility of the V-LAPTM to accurately measure LAP.

The study showed that in an animal model, the implantation of the novel wireless left atrial pressure sensor V-LAP™ was feasible, safe, and showed good accuracy and precision.
